Core Insights - ServiceNow reported a total revenue of $3.215 billion for Q2 2025, with subscription revenue reaching $3.113 billion, marking a year-on-year growth of 21.5% and exceeding guidance by approximately 200 basis points [2][11]. - The remaining performance obligation (RPO) increased to $23.9 billion, a 25.5% year-on-year growth, providing solid visibility for future performance [2][12]. - The company is advancing its "Agentic AI" strategy, with significant growth in its Now Assist and Plus family products, showcasing strong market demand and operational efficiency improvements [3][13]. - ServiceNow is challenging traditional CRM vendors, with 17 out of the top 20 deals in Q2 being for CRM and industry workflow solutions, reflecting a 70% increase year-on-year [4][14]. - The company raised its full-year subscription revenue guidance for FY 2025 by $125 million, projecting a total of $12.775 billion to $12.795 billion, which represents a year-on-year growth of approximately 20% [5][15]. Summary by Sections Financial Performance - Total revenue for Q2 2025 was $3.215 billion, with subscription revenue at $3.113 billion, accounting for 96.8% of total revenue [2][11]. - Non-GAAP operating margin improved by 250 basis points to 29.5%, and free cash flow margin increased by 300 basis points to 16.5% [2][12]. AI Strategy - The "Agentic AI" strategy is being implemented effectively, with Now Assist's new ACV exceeding expectations and significant growth in related products [3][13]. - AI tools developed internally are expected to save approximately $100 million in labor costs this year [3][13]. CRM and Industry Workflow - ServiceNow's integrated CRM solutions have gained traction, with a notable increase in large deals since the acquisition of Logik.ai [4][14]. - The company has been recognized as a leader in CRM customer experience and service by Gartner [4][14]. Future Guidance - The company has raised its subscription revenue forecast for FY 2025 to between $12.775 billion and $12.795 billion, with a third-quarter guidance of $3.26 billion to $3.265 billion [5][15]. - ServiceNow aims to achieve $1.5 billion in Now Assist ACV by the end of 2026, indicating a strong long-term growth strategy [5][15].

AI Market Growth & Trends - AI infrastructure spending has reached $0.5 trillion, yet many companies are limited to basic chatbots and code generation [2] - Anthropic's annualized revenue has grown rapidly, 3xing in 5 months, reaching $3 billion by the end of May [3] - OpenAI is projected to reach $12 billion in revenue by the end of 2025, a 3x increase from the previous year, driven by enterprise AI spending [4] - Cost per token for AI inference dropped dramatically by 99.7% from 2022 to 2024 [33] - Google searches for "AI agents" increased 11x in the last 16 months [34] Retool's Agentic AI Solution - Retool is breaking into Agentic AI with the release of Retool Agents, enabling enterprises to build agents with guardrails that integrate into production systems [2] - Retool customers have automated over 100 million hours of work, freeing up human potential [31] - Retool's cheapest agent is priced at $3 per hour [33] Agent Development Strategies - Companies have four options for agent development: building from scratch, using a framework like Lang graph, using an agent platform like Retool Agents, or using verticalized agents [16][17][18][19] - The decision to build or buy agents depends on whether it's part of the core product, involves regulated data, or is a commodity workflow needed quickly [21] - When considering a managed platform, evaluate the breadth of connectors, built-in permissioning, compliance, audit trails, and observability [22][23] Enterprise Considerations for AI Agents - Enterprises need to consider single sign-on, role-based access control, secure integration with external services, audit logs, compliance, and internationalization when deploying AI agents [13][14] - Risks of using AI-generated code in production include hallucinations, unpredictable results, security vulnerabilities, and cost overruns [15]
